Navigating the Single Supplement Challenge

One of the biggest financial hurdles for solo cruisers is the dreaded 'single supplement.' Most cruise fares are based on double occupancy, meaning two people sharing a cabin. When a solo traveller books a cabin, the cruise line often charges a supplement, which can range from 150% to 200% of the per-person rate. This means you could be paying almost as much as two people, just to have the cabin to yourself. This practice effectively penalizes those who wish to travel alone, making cruising a much more expensive proposition.

This is where finding a cruise partner through the Travel Buddy Community becomes a game-changer. By finding a compatible travel buddy to share a cabin, you immediately cut your accommodation cost in half. You pay the standard per-person, double-occupancy rate, just like everyone else. The money saved is substantial and can be reallocated to enhance your trip in other ways: you could upgrade to a balcony cabin, book more exciting shore excursions, indulge in a spa treatment, or even fund your next cruise! Finding a partner isn’t just about companionship; it's a strategic financial decision that makes cruising far more accessible and affordable. It democratizes the experience, allowing you to enjoy all the perks of a voyage without the unfair financial penalty of travelling solo.

Mediterranean Wonders: Sun, History, and Shared Dinners

A Mediterranean cruise is a journey through the cradle of Western civilization, a vibrant tapestry of culture, cuisine, and coastal beauty. Sharing this experience with a travel partner amplifies its magic. Imagine standing together in the Colosseum in Rome, sharing a moment of awe before millennia of history. Picture yourselves navigating the labyrinthine streets of Mykonos, discovering a hidden taverna, and sharing a delicious meal of fresh seafood as the sun sets over the Aegean Sea. These are experiences that become richer through shared perspective and conversation. Exploring bustling markets like La Boqueria in Barcelona or the Grand Bazaar in Istanbul is also safer and more enjoyable with a second pair of eyes and a shared sense of adventure.

Planning a Mediterranean cruise is best done for the shoulder seasons, spring (April to June) and autumn (September to October). During these months, the weather is pleasant, the summer crowds have thinned, and the prices are often more reasonable. With a cruise partner, you can plan your shore excursions together, perhaps opting for a private wine-tasting tour in Tuscany or a guided walk through the ruins of Pompeii. Back on board, the day's discoveries fuel your dinner conversation, transforming a simple meal into a continuation of your adventure. Finding a partner who shares your passion for history, art, or simply relaxing on a beautiful beach is the key to unlocking the very best of a Mediterranean voyage.

The Magic of the Caribbean: Turquoise Waters and Island Rhythms

Escaping to the Caribbean is the ultimate antidote to winter blues, a symphony of warm sunshine, turquoise waters, and laid-back island culture. A Caribbean cruise with a travel partner is an invitation to shared fun and relaxation. Together, you can explore the diverse personalities of each island port. One day, you might be snorkeling hand-in-hand through the vibrant coral reefs of a marine park in Belize; the next, you're enjoying a rum punch on a pristine white-sand beach in Barbados. Activities that might seem daunting alone, like ziplining through a Dominican rainforest or learning to salsa in San Juan, become exciting shared challenges with a companion by your side.

The best time to cruise the Caribbean is typically from December to April, when the weather is at its driest and most pleasant. This is peak season, but sharing the cost makes it much more manageable. When looking for a partner on urlaubspartner.net for a Caribbean trip, discuss what kind of island experience you both prefer. Are you drawn to the bustling energy and shopping of St. Maarten, the natural beauty and hiking of St. Lucia, or the historic charm of Curaçao? Aligning your interests ensures that your shore excursions are a source of mutual enjoyment. Whether it's co-navigating a rented beach buggy, trying different local foods at each stop, or simply relaxing on the balcony and watching the world drift by, a Caribbean cruise is an idyllic setting for building a new travel friendship.

Discovering the Baltic Sea: A Voyage Through Culture and Capitals

For those whose interests lean more towards history, art, and grand architecture, a Baltic Sea cruise is an unforgettable experience. This itinerary is a dense and rewarding journey through the heart of Northern Europe, often including magnificent capitals like Stockholm, Copenhagen, Tallinn, and Helsinki. Sharing this culturally rich voyage with a companion allows for deeper appreciation and stimulating conversations. You can discuss the blend of medieval and modern design in Tallinn's Old Town, marvel together at the intricate beauty of the Hermitage Museum in St. Petersburg (when itineraries permit), or share a traditional Danish pastry in a cozy Copenhagen café. Navigating the public transport in each new city is far less intimidating with a partner to help read maps and make decisions.

The prime season for a Baltic cruise is during the summer months, from June to August. This is when you'll experience the famous 'White Nights,' with long hours of daylight that allow for maximum exploration in each port. The weather is mild, and the cities are alive with festivals and outdoor activities. When searching for a partner for this type of cruise, look for someone who shares your curiosity and stamina. Days in port can be long and packed with sightseeing. Finding a buddy who is just as excited as you are to explore the Vasa Museum in Stockholm or wander through the art nouveau district in Helsinki will make the trip exceptionally rewarding. It's a journey for the mind and the senses, made all the better with someone to share the wonder.

Vetting Your First Mate: From Profile to Port

The success of your shared cruise adventure hinges on finding a genuinely compatible partner. This process of getting to know each other is the most critical step you'll take before booking anything. Start by spending time on the urlaubspartner.net platform. Read profiles carefully and engage in detailed messaging. Once you've established a good initial rapport, it's essential to move the conversation to a video call. Seeing someone's face and hearing their voice builds trust and gives you a much better sense of their personality than text alone.

During your video calls, be prepared to discuss the 'Big Three': budget, habits, and expectations. Be transparent about your total budget for the cruise, including onboard spending, shore excursions, and drinks. Discuss your travel style: are you an early riser or a night owl? Do you plan every minute of your day, or do you prefer to be spontaneous? Talk about cabin etiquette. It's a small space, so discussing cleanliness, privacy expectations, and guest policies is not awkward, it's smart. A great way to test your compatibility is to plan a hypothetical shore excursion together. This small collaborative task can reveal a lot about your communication styles and ability to compromise. Remember, you're not just looking for someone to split the cost; you're looking for a respectful, reliable, and pleasant companion. Take your time, trust your intuition, and don't commit to a trip until you feel confident and comfortable.

Onboard Harmony: Preparing for a Smooth Sailing Experience

Once you've found your cruise partner and booked your trip, the next phase is preparing for a harmonious onboard experience. Clear communication before you sail can prevent many potential issues at sea. A key topic is finances. While you've split the main cost, there are many onboard expenses. Decide in advance how you'll handle them. Will you have separate onboard accounts linked to your own credit cards? This is often the simplest and cleanest method. If you plan to share the cost of things like a bottle of wine at dinner or a taxi in port, agree on a system, whether it’s taking turns paying or using a payment app to settle up regularly. Discussing money upfront removes potential awkwardness later.

Next, think about packing. Coordinate on some items to save space. Does the cabin have a hairdryer? There's no need to bring two. You can also discuss dress codes. How many formal nights does your cruise have? Will you both participate? Aligning on this ensures no one feels over- or under-dressed. Finally, talk about communication and personal space. A cruise ship can be a massive place, so agree on how to stay in touch, especially on days at sea when phone service is non-existent. Many cruise lines have their own messaging apps. Also, respect each other's need for alone time. It's perfectly fine if one person wants to read a book on the balcony while the other attends a line-dancing class. Flexibility, respect, and open communication are the pillars of a successful partnership, ensuring your voyage is smooth sailing from start to finish.

Who books the cruise?

You and your new travel partner book the cruise yourselves. urlaubspartner.net is a community platform, not a travel agency. You should book together, or have a very clear, written agreement on how the booking will be handled to ensure both parties are protected.

How do we handle the single cabin?

This requires an open discussion before booking. Talk about cleanliness, privacy, sleeping schedules, and whether you are comfortable with either person bringing back a guest (many members agree on a 'no guests' rule). Setting these boundaries early is key to a comfortable experience.

What if my travel partner cancels at the last minute?

This is a risk, which is why travel insurance is essential. Ensure your policy covers cancellation for any reason, if possible. You should also have a written agreement between yourselves about cancellation penalties and how deposits will be handled.

How do we split the costs of the cruise?

Typically, the main cruise fare is split 50/50, as this is the primary goal. For onboard expenses, the easiest method is for each person to have their own separate onboard account linked to their own credit card. Discuss how you'll handle shared costs like a shared taxi before the trip.

Should we book a cabin with one bed or two?

For a new travel partnership, always request a cabin with two twin beds. Most cruise ship cabins can be configured with either one king bed or two separate twins. Make sure you confirm a twin-bed configuration with the cruise line when booking.

Is it better to choose a short or long cruise for a first trip together?

For your first trip with a new travel partner, it's often wise to start with a shorter cruise, perhaps 3 to 5 nights. This lowers the financial and time commitment and acts as a 'test run' for your compatibility. If it goes well, you can plan a longer voyage for your next adventure.

Should our passports be from the same country?

Not necessarily, but it is a critical point to discuss. Different nationalities can have different visa requirements for the same cruise ports. You must both verify your individual visa needs for every single port of call on the itinerary before booking.

Can I trust my travel partner with my cabin key card?

Each person will receive their own individual key card from the cruise line. This card is your room key, your onboard ID, and your method of payment. There should be no reason to share it or give it to your travel partner.
